How to sell bitcoin

All exchanges license you to sell as well as buy. What type of exchange you choose to sell your bitcoin will be subject to what type of holder you are: small investor, recognized holder or trader?

Platforms such as GDAX and Gemini are aimed more at large instructions from institutional investors and traders.

Retail customers can sell bitcoin at exchanges such as Coinbase, Kraken, Bitstamp, Poloniex, etc. Each exchange has a changed interface, and some offer interrelated services such as secure storage. Some require confirmed identification for all trades, while others are more comfortable if small amounts are involved.

(Of course, don’t forget to affirm any profit you make on the sale to your appropriate tax authority!)

You can, if you desire, exchange your bitcoin for other crypto moneys rather than for cash. Some exchanges such as Shapeshift emphasis on this service, allowing you to exchange between bitcoin and ether, litecoin, XRP, dash and several others.

Added alternative is the direct sale. You can index as a seller on platforms such as LocalBitcoins, BitQuick, Bittylicious and BitBargain, and concerned parties will contact you if they like your price. Transactions are usually done through deposits or wires to your bank account, after which you are likely to transfer the agreed amount of bitcoin to the specified address.

Or, you can sell directly to friends and family as soon as they have a bitcoin wallet set up. Just send the bitcoin, collect the cash or mobile payment, and have a congratulatory drink together.

 

How do bitcoin transaction work?

Now that you’ve established your bitcoin wallet and are ready to make your first business, let’s take a look at how bitcoin businesses actually work. 

There are three key variables in any bitcoin business: an amount, an input and an output. An input is the address from which the cash is sent, and an output is the address that accepts the funds. Since a wallet can contain numerous input addresses, you can send money from one or more inputs to one or more outputs. There is also a statistics storage portion on each transaction, a sort of note, that allows you to input data to the block chain immutably.

But the exceptional thing about bitcoin transactions is that, if you pledge a transaction that’s worth less than the total amount in your input, you get your change back not to your unique output, but through a new third address in your control. This means your wallet classically ends up containing multiple addresses, and you can pull moneys from these addresses to make future transactions.

You’ve learned how to buy and store your bitcoins, so you now know what public and private keys are for, and you’ll need these to production a transaction. To do that, you put your private key, the sum of bitcoins you want to send and the output address into the bitcoin software on your computer or smartphone.

Then the program creates a signature made from your private key to publicize this transaction to the network for validation. The network wishes to confirm that you own the bitcoin being transferred and that you haven’t spent it by examining all previous transactions which are public on the register. Once the bitcoin program confirms that indeed your private key agrees to the provided public key, your transaction is complete.

This transaction is now comprised in a “block” which gets close to the previous block to be added to the blockchain. Every transaction in the blockchain is knotted to a single identifier called a transaction hash (txid), which looks like a 64-character string of unsystematic letters and numbers. You can track a specific transaction by typing this txid in the search bar on the block chain explorer.

Transactions can’t be uncompleted or tampered with, because it would mean re-doing all the blocks that came after. This process is not prompt. Because the bitcoin blockchain is fairly big, it takes a lot of time to process a single transaction among the numerous on the blockchain.

The amount of time it takes to check a transaction varies, ranging anywhere from a few minutes to a team days, based on traffic on the blockchain and the size of your deal. Larger transactions with higher fees tend to get legalized by miners quicker than smaller ones. That said, once it is established, it is immutably recorded forever.
